Chauli Population - Ranchi, Jharkhand

Chauli is a medium size village located in Ratu Block of Ranchi district, Jharkhand with total 62 families residing. The Chauli village has population of 351 of which 174 are males while 177 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Chauli village population of children with age 0-6 is 41 which makes up 11.68 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Chauli village is 1017 which is higher than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Chauli as per census is 1050, higher than Jharkhand average of 948.

Chauli village has higher liter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Chauli village was 70.32 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Chauli Male literacy stands at 80.52 % while female literacy rate was 60.26 %.

Caste Factor

In Chauli village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 77.21 % of total population in Chauli village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Chauli village of Ranchi.

Work Profile

In Chauli village out of total population, 124 were engaged in work activities. 96.77 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 3.23 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 124 workers engaged in Main Work, 99 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 8 were Agricultural labourer.
